Last week I said I’d be reviewing the new cake from Cold Stone Creamery.

We had it for Father’s Day (except my mom who doesn’t like chocolate and my one daughter who gets sick from it.) Here are our thoughts.

My Dad:

  • Rich but delicious
  • Couldn’t really taste peanut butter
  • Don’t need a big piece since it’s so rich

My Husband:

  • Too rich
  • Otherwise Yummy
  • I’m not a big cake eater but I ate it all

Me:

  • Rich but still was able to eat a big piece
  • Loved the reese cup on top dipped in graham cracker crumbs
  • Why is the serving size 8 but there are 6 reese cups? Everyone should get one on their piece.
  • Oops. Forgot to let it sit out before eating, no wonder we can’t cut through it!
  • Very yummy but too expensive! I know it’s a speciality cake but ouch! Not for the empty of pocket. Maybe if it were bigger.
  • I tasted peanut butter on my first bite
